2. Where It All Began: The Musk Deer
The story of the musk starts with the humble, little creature that is found in the forests of Asia: the musk deer. Commonly about the size of a small dog, these animals were the source of natural musk. Male musk deers excrete this strong-smelling substance as a means of marking territory and attracting mates. Hard as it may be to believe, this smell became one of the most treasured ingredients in perfumery.
The demand for musk was so great that it was once substituted as a form of currency in various ancient cultures. Merchants would embark on long journeys, carrying valuable musk from the mountains of Tibet, Nepal, and Siberia to rich buyers worldwide.
3. How Musk Was Collected in Ancient Times
So, how was musk perfume from deer made? It wasn’t easy. For hunters to be able to extract musk, they would kill the male musk deer and remove the small gland, which produced this powerful scent. This included a thick, paste-like substance which after drying turned into musk granules. After that, perfumes would be made of the musk granules.
Musk was said to possess magical powers in ancient times: to make someone stronger and last longer and even more appealing to the opposite sex. It had been used not only for perfumery but also for medicinal purposes and rituals. It was so highly regarded that only royalty and the ultra-rich could afford it.
4. Musk’s Journey into Perfumery
Musk rose rather quickly up the ladder of perfumery. The ancient Egyptians, Greeks, and Romans applied musk to their perfumes since people were attracted to this long-lasting and seductive ingredient. Musk became the base note in many famous fragrances, adding depth and sensuality to any blend it touched.
One thing about musk perfume coming from deer is how long it lasts. It is very strong, and because of that, a little can last hours, even days. For this reason, it was the perfect ingredient to ground more volatile top notes like citrus and florals. As time passed, musk began to embody luxury, sensuality, and mystery.
5. Musk Perfume from Deer: A Controversial History
This was not a cheap obsession with musk, though musk deer paid the price for this. The demand for musk perfume made from deer led to their overhunting, and in the 19th century, the musk deer population was shrinking. The killing of these animals for musk became controversial, raising questions about the use of animal-derived ingredients in perfumes.
At one time, musk was so valuable it was worth its weight in gold! But as conservation and awareness about it grew, perfumers began to look for alternatives. And that marked the beginning of synthetic musk concoction that smelled like natural musk but did not have to be cruelly derived from animals.
6. The Switch to Synthetic Musk
Artificial musk was a godsend for the perfume industry. It could now use musk in perfumes without being dependent on the highly dwindling numbers of musk deer. Synthetic musk, first manufactured during the late 19th century, was labelled “Nitro-musk,” and shortly thereafter it gained widespread acceptance.
Today, the majority of musk used in perfumery is synthetic. Cruelty-free, cheap, and more available than natural musk, And while synthetic musk may lack the true depth and character of its animal counterpart, it has become an invaluable tool in modern perfumery. Most probably a number of the perfumes you use or love contain one form of synthetic musk or another.

From Ancient Egypt to Modern Times: A Long and Winding Road
The history of deer musk perfume dates back to ancient times. Musk’s evidence shows that it was used by the Egyptians as early as 3,000 BC, whereas Chinese and Indian cultures also adopted the fragrance into their respective traditions of perfumery. Throughout centuries, musk perfume remained a luxury product, favored by royalty and the elite.

Plant-Based Musk: Nature’s Bounty for Fragrance
Natural perfumery has also responded to the challenge with some brilliant alternative plants like ambrette seed and angelica root possess musky tones and enable vegan, sustainable musk fragrances to be developed.
